I am in the process of reading a book by Bob Deans entitled "The River Where America Began: A Journey Along The James" which covers the history of the James River in Virginia from about 1600 to 2006.  The book is well written although I had never heard Bob Deans' name mentioned before as an author although he has published at least three books.  Not only is the writing quite good but so is the research which is as good as just about anything I have read in quite some time.  The list of resources is actually about ten pages long which is rare today even in works which are labeled as historical nonfiction.  I will write in more length about the book when I have completely finished it but I found a little section which I cannot resist writing about immediately because of its logical application to American politics.  

On page 142, in a section carrying the subtitle "To Virginia Or Be Hanged" there is a discussion of the life and work of Virginia Colonial Governor William Berkeley who was governor of the colony twice from 1641 to 1652 and from 1660 to 1677.  The author quotes and comments on some of Berkeley's writing which can be applied to American politics today with just as much pertinence as it carried when it was written in the late 17th century. 

"...Berkeley was no democrat, at least not the way future Virginia leaders would define the term.  "I thank God there are no free schools nor printing" in Virginia, Berkelely reported to a royal commission in 1670, explaining that educated people were hard to control and  a free press exposed government to critics.  "God keep us from both."  (Deans p. 142)

Governor Berkeley wrote those words to the king or his subordinates in 1670 and, yet today, those words are just as pertinent to what is happening in America and American politics as anything which can be discussed.   I take note here of Bob Deans' use of the uncapitalized form of the word "democrat" and recognize that his choice to do so is appropriate since, during Berkeley's time, there was no Democratic party in America and the appropriate meaning of the word was simply a believer in or practitioner of democracy. One of my favorite websites about banned books is run by a site known as Punchnels and they have an article entitled "10 Reasons for Banning Books, and 5 Much Better Reasons Not To".  I will be using that article as an outline for this blog post and will attempt to expand on their key points while also making several dozen of my own.  I will discuss each of their reasons one by one and attempt to further elucidate my reasons for why they are correct while also providing further examples of books which fit into each of these categories they discuss.

1) Racial Themes: Numerous books have been banned in America, or portions of the country, for this very reason.  "The Adventures Of Huckleberry Finn" was banned in many locations for many years after its publication because it cast two runaways, one a white juvenile running from a drunken and abusive father and the other a runaway black slave.  In recent times, it has been banned for an absolutely different reason, the use of the "N" word several times.  In my estimation and that of many others, neither of these reasons justified banning a masterpiece such as "The Adventures Of Huckleberry Finn".  "To Kill A Mockingbird" was also banned for many years because it was written about a white southern attorney who defended a black man in a court of law.  John Howard Griffin's "Black Like Me" was also banned because Griffin, a white author, successfully posed as a black man in the Deep South in order to understand racial prejudice.  There is a much longer list of wonderful books which have been banned over the last 250 years in America because they addressed racial themes.

2) Alternative Lifestyles: Nearly as many books have been banned for this reason as have been banned for discussing racial themes.  Numerous books which have addressed LGBTQ themes have been banned in America.  Many of them are still banned in small enclaves such as religious based schools, Third World Countries, tyrannical and despotic countries, conservative communities, and other unique areas.  This list of books may also include books about crime, gang activity, drug use, polygamy, polyandry, polyamory, mental illness, and prostitution.  Some of these reasons for banning also touch the edges of sexual and/or racial themes which are actually a completely separate reason for banning books. 3)  Profanity: Profanity alone has also caused many books to be banned including the works of Erica Jong, John Steinbeck, and many others.  Ms. Jong's books were also frequently banned due to their highly sexual nature so she often found herself and her work caught between a rock and a hard place although she has still managed to publish more than 25 books in at least three genres.  More power to her!  "The Grapes Of Wrath" and "The Great Gatsby" have also been banned because of their salty language.  "The Great Gatsby" plays a large role in the book "Reading Lolita in Tehran" by Azar Nafisi which I have recently read and written about on this blog.  Ms. Nafisi's highly acclaimed work has been banned in her native Iran for similar reasons.  I cannot recommend any book more highly than hers.

4) Sex: The article "10 Reasons for Banning Books and 5 Much Better Reason Not To" on the Punchnel's website which I am referring to frequently in this blog post states in their discussion of this topic that "not just graphic sexual content, but also dialogue of a sexual nature, any and all references to reproductive acts, and even the barest, briefest, Disney-approved sensuality" can result in a book being banned by the small minded and heavy handed book banners anywhere.  Books which have been banned because of sexual content include "Fanny Hill" by John Cleland, "Fear Of Flying" by Erica Jong, and "A Farewell To Arms" by Ernest Hemingway.  All are excellent literature and have proven themselves to be far more consequential in America and the world than the people who banned them.

5) Violence: Violence can sometimes be the official public cause for banning a book when the real reasons may  be nebulous, unnamed, and more questionable in nature.  Books which have been banned because of their violence include "One Flew Over The Cuckoo's Nest" by Ken Kesey but the real reason for its banning was often related more to the fact that the protagonists in the book were residents in a mental institution.  "Lord Of The Flies" by William Golding was probably banned most often because it involved teen age boys in a setting where they had to wear no clothes.  "Fifty Shades of Grey" by E. 8)  Unpopular Religious Views: Both C. S. Lewis' "Chronicles Of Narnia" and J. R. R. Tolkien's "Lord Of The Rings" have been banned as being anything from "anti-Christian", "satanic", or "atheistic" when both authors were deeply religious and created these works as Christian allegories.  In fact, in addition to the banned children's books, Lewis also wrote two highly respected non-fiction works on Christian theology, "Mere Christianity" "The Weight Of Glory", and the fictional "Screwtape Letters" which is also deeply religious but couched in the form of letters home by a junior devil sent to earth to help the efforts of Satan.  Other unpopular religious works have included those related to Scientology, atheism, agnosticism, Judaism, Jehovah's Witnesses, Later Day Saints, and most other religions which can viewed as being outside the mainstream in a Christian country.  Additionally, several Muslim countries have banned religious books such as the Holy Bible, the Khama Sutra, and works related to Buddhism, Confucianism, Taoism, and most other non-Muslim religions.

"When Even Angels Wept..." reads at times like a Shakespearean tragedy.  Joseph McCarthy was a poor Irish Catholic Wisconsin farm boy who grew up poor and rose to great power before his gargantuan psychological and moral flaws hamstrung him and brought him down just as permanently as that single unwashed tendon brought an end to Achilles.  McCarthy attended high school as an older student and finished in what was affirmed to be record time while supporting himself by selling eggs to grocers in Milwaukee.  He sailed through law school at Marquette University, was elected to a local judgeship, and joined the Marines when WWII broke out.  However, the record shows, as detailed by Thomas, that while in the Marines, McCarthy deftly finagled his way out of combat situations, managed to describe a common accident as a medal worthy combat wound, and set himself up to run for the US Senate from Wisconsin.  He was living the life of a pirate every day of his life and when he got to Washington that life became magnified, aggrandized, and blown out of all proportion to his actual qualifications and achievements.  Joseph McCarthy was a self-serving freebooter who went about gaining the chairmanship of a relatively minor committee in the senate.  Then he managed, by his criminal interference in the lives of the innocent, to turn that committee into the most publicly notorious arm of the federal government. In just a handful of years, McCarthy destroyed the lives of thousands of innocent victims in order to paint himself as a leader who was worthy of public office. 

However, the book reveals that McCarthy's vast, self-destructive psychological flaws led to his demise along with his alcoholism which was simultaneously destroying his health.  Joseph McCarthy died a premature death at 49 after having been brought into check by his senate colleagues who censured him due to his freebooter ways in the conduct of his investigations.  He was brought up short at the end of his chain much like an ill tempered dog.  There is a great deal to be learned by the average reader and voter by reading any available literature about the life of McCarthy and this book is a great place to start.  Read it with a jaundiced eye due to the somewhat overly positive portrayal which is provided by Lately Thomas at times.  Read it with an eye to the current ongoing political disaster in Washington.  Read it with the intent to find tools to be used in the political resistance necessary to protect our democracy and constitutional rights.
